She graduated from a Business Academy. She started dancing in amateur groups and on dancing internships.

In 2002 she gained a scholarship for a dance practical training in v Calabria ArteDanza in Italy (International Dance Meeting).

She participated on many dance workshops with Czech abd foreign lecturers (Nina Brzorádová, Václav Janeček, Veronika Iblová, Jan Kodet, Lenka Vágnerová, Sebastin Belmar, Ohad Naharin, Sonia Rodriques, Jacek Przybylowicz, Jacek Tyski, Michelle Asaf, Michele Oliva, Steve Lachance, Terry Beeman, Wes Veldink, Jason Parsons, and others).

As of 2008 she is a member of Prague Chamber Ballet, where she dances in choreographies Who is the most powerful on the world?, Mono No Aware (H.Turečková), The Condition of Disappearance (Ji-Eun Lee), Beat (Ivgi&Greben), From My Life, Sinfonietta (P.Šmok), Slavonic Quartet (M.Radačovský). She further danced in choreographies of Lucie Holánková, Jan Kodet and others.

She collaborated with various choreographers, for example with Libor Vaculík (musicals Angelika, Rebels, Lucrezia Borgia), Richard Hes (musicals Dracula, Monte Christo, Golem), Quaša (Musical elixir of life), Kristina Kloubková (musicals Baron Munchausen, Dinner for Adele), Pavel Strouhal (musical Carmen), Jana Burkiewiczová (musical Quasimodo), Jan Kodet (opera Rusalka).

She further participated for example in recording of TV films Rebels (F.Renč), Roming (J.Vejdělek), Doom (Andrzej Bartkowiak). She danced at Křižík fountain in ballets The Little Mermaid, Carmen, Romeo and Julie.
